Keynote · Demo
24 主题 · 30 版式 · 25 动效 · 零构建
Agenda
每次做 PPT 都在重复劳动,而这件事 99% 可以模板化。
tokens + layouts + animations,三层分离。
同一份 deck,一键切 24 种主题。
好的演讲稿是写出来的,
不是「做」出来的。
— 每一个被 PPT 折磨过的人
The result
10 份真实 deck 的平均测试数据。
How · 核心思路
:root每一种视觉属性——颜色、字体、圆角、阴影——都变成语义变量。
--text-1 / --text-2 / --text-3--surface / --surface-2--accent / --accent-2 / --accent-3--radius / --shadow / --grad
/* assets/themes/aurora.css */
:root {
--bg: #06091c;
--text-1: #e8f0ff;
--accent: #5ef2c6;
--accent-2: #7aa2ff;
--accent-3: #c984ff;
--radius: 20px;
}
——整个 aurora 主题就这么大。
Numbers · 实际效果
Your turn
复制一份 deck,换你的内容,按 T 选一个最对味的主题,讲完还能一键导 PNG。
./scripts/new-deck.sh my-talk←/→ 翻页 · T 主题 · A 动效 · F 全屏 · O 概览 · S 备注
lewis · sudolewis@gmail.com · MIT 2026